Calories: 385 per serving1. Place the chicken, butter, soup, and onion in a slow cooker, and fill with enough water to cover.
2. Cover, and cook for 5 to 6 hours on High. About 30 minutes before serving, place the torn biscuit dough in the slow cooker. Cook until the dough is no longer raw in the center.

Ratings: 15Calories: 244 per servingTotal Time: 6 hrs 15 mins1. In a slow cooker, layer the minced or chopped onion and garlic on the bottom. Add cubed chicken breast pieces, then top with vegetables: potato, carrot, celery, corn.
2. Combine dry ingredients (flour, baking powder, sugar, and salt) in a large mixing bowl or the bowl of your stand mixer. Cut the butter into the dry ingredients, until crumbly and about pea sized. Add milk and stir until a rough dough ball is formed.

How to cook chicken and cream of mushroom soup in crock pot?

Directions. Combine chicken, cream of mushroom soup, onion, butter, rosemary, and black pepper in a slow cooker; add enough vegetable broth to cover the ingredients completely. Cook on High for 4 1/2 to 5 1/2 hours. Arrange torn biscuit dough on top of chicken mixture; continue cooking until dough is cooked through, about 30 minutes more.
